Haryana ·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 1991
Shamsher Singh S/o Ganga Singh of Indian National Congress won the Narwana (SC)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Haryana in the 1991 state assembly election, securing 23,445 votes (34.40% vote share). The runner-up was Gauri Shanker (Haryana Vikas Party) with 16,284 votes.
A total of 36 candidates contested this assembly seat. | Position | Candidate Name | Votes | Votes% | Party |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Shamsher Singh S/o Ganga Singh | 23445 | 34.40% | Indian National Congress |
| 2 | Gauri Shanker | 16284 | 23.90% | Haryana Vikas Party |
| 3 | Tek Chand S/o Risala | 15609 | 22.90% | Jharkhand Party |
| 4 | Tek Chand S/i Amilal | 4001 | 5.90% | Independent |
| 5 | Balwant S/o Ram Sarup | 3019 | 4.40% | Independent |
| 6 | Birbal Dass | 1880 | 2.80% | Independent |
| 7 | Ranbir Kaur | 1548 | 2.30% | Bharatiya Janata Party |
| 8 | Yogendra Pal | 332 | 0.50% | Independent |
| 9 | Tek Chand S/o Gopi Ram | 239 | 0.40% | Independent |
| 10 | Mange Ram | 218 | 0.30% | Independent |
| 11 | Raghbir S/o Ami Lal | 205 | 0.30% | Independent |
| 12 | Jaili Ram | 156 | 0.20% | Independent |
| 13 | Zile Singh S/o Rattan Singh | 145 | 0.20% | Independent |
| 14 | Kuldip Singh | 111 | 0.20% | Independent |
| 15 | Umesh Chand | 85 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 16 | Sharda | 78 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 17 | Satbir Singh S/o Devatram | 70 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 17 | Subhash | 70 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 19 | Sat Parkash | 63 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 20 | Dilbagh Singh | 61 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 21 | Om Parkash | 59 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 22 | Raghbir S/o Girdhala | 55 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 23 | Des Raj | 53 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 24 | Satbir S/o Nihala | 44 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 25 | Balwant S/o Shersingh | 43 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 26 | Roshan Lal | 35 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 26 | Jai Bhagwan | 35 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 28 | Dhira Alias Randhir | 34 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 28 | Shamsher Singh S/o Karam Singh | 34 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 28 | Keshar Singh | 34 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 31 | Ram Kumar | 31 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 32 | Angrej Singh | 28 | 0.00% | Independent |
| 32 | Inder Singh | 28 | 0.00% | Independent |
| 34 | Raja Ram | 20 | 0.00% | Independent |
| 35 | Sanjiv | 19 | 0.00% | Independent |
| 36 | Zile Singh S/o Hari Ram | 5 | 0.00% | Independent |
